Агуулгын хүснэгт:

PyTables гэж юу вэ?
PyTables гэж юу вэ?

Видео: PyTables гэж юу вэ?

Видео: PyTables гэж юу вэ?
Видео: HDF5 take 2 - h5py & PyTables | SciPy 2017 Tutorial | Tom Kooij 2024, Арваннэгдүгээр
Anonim

PyTables нь шаталсан өгөгдлийн багцыг удирдах багц бөгөөд маш их хэмжээний өгөгдлийг үр дүнтэй, хялбар даван туулахад зориулагдсан. PyTables Python хэл болон NumPy багцыг ашиглан HDF5 номын сангийн дээд талд бүтээгдсэн.

Үүнийг анхаарч үзвэл, би PyTable-ийг хэрхэн суулгах вэ?

PyTables-ийг pip ашиглан суулгах хамгийн энгийн арга бол дараах байдалтай байна

  1. $ pip суулгах хүснэгтүүд.
  2. $ pip install --user --upgrade хүснэгтүүд.
  3. $ pip install --install-option='--hdf5=/custom/path/to/hdf5' хүснэгтүүд.
  4. $ env HDF5_DIR=/custom/path/to/hdf5 pip суулгах хүснэгтүүд.
  5. $ pip суулгах хүснэгтүүд-3.0.0.tar.gz.

Хоёрдугаарт, hdf5 нь мэдээллийн сан мөн үү? 3 хариулт. HDF5 зэрэгцэн уншихад тохиромжтой. Зэрэгцээ бичих хандалтын хувьд та зэрэгцээ ашиглах хэрэгтэй HDF5 эсвэл бичихэд анхаарал тавьдаг ажилчин процесстой байх HDF5 дэлгүүр. Та SQL/NoSQL-д мета-мэдээлэл хадгалах боломжтой мэдээллийн сан болон түүхий өгөгдлийг (цаг хугацааны цувааны өгөгдөл) нэг буюу олон хэлбэрээр хадгалах HDF5 файлууд

Үүний нэгэн адил хүмүүс hdf5 файл гэж юу вэ?

Шаталсан өгөгдлийн формат 5 ( HDF5 ), нээлттэй эх сурвалж юм файл том, нарийн төвөгтэй, нэг төрлийн бус өгөгдлийг дэмждэг формат. HDF5 "-г ашигладаг файл лавлах" гэх мэт бүтэц нь доторх өгөгдлийг цэгцлэх боломжийг олгодог файл Таны хийж болох олон янзын бүтэцтэй арга замаар файлууд таны компьютер дээр.

Hdf5 суулгасан эсэхийг яаж мэдэх вэ?

Танд zlib байгаа эсэхийг шалгаарай суулгасан . Энэ нь шахалтанд шаардлагатай (дүлхэх) HDF5 шүүлтүүр. руу эсэхийг шалгана уу энэ бол суулгасан , үзнэ үү хэрэв Энэ нь таны номын санд байдаг (жишээ нь /usr/lib эсвэл /usr/lib64). Хялбар арга шалгах Энэ нь ls /usr/lib | командыг ажиллуулах явдал юм grep "libz".

Зөвлөмж болгож буй: